President Obama Earns Widespread Praise for His Respectful Tribute to Romney and McCain

In a moment capturing the true spirit of civility and respect, former President Barack Obama recently drew widespread admiration for his heartfelt comments about his Republican presidential rivals, Mitt Romney and John McCain. During his appearance at the “Presidential Center” — an event emphasizing leadership and history — Obama paid tribute not just to their political roles but also to their personal character, calling them “good people with different views.”

The social media buzz surged after an image surfaced of the Oval Office setting, featuring a quote attributed to Obama: “The absolute grace of President Obama mentioning the two men he ran against, McCain and Romney, as good people with different perspectives.” The quote resonated deeply with many Americans, highlighting a rare display of bipartisan respect in an era often marked by divisiveness.

Obama’s comments reflect a contrasting approach to political disagreement in modern times. Instead of focusing on rivalries and contrasting their policies, he emphasized the qualities that transcend politics: civility, respect, and shared patriotism. The former president remarked, “While we may have had our debates and disagreements, I always recognized John McCain’s service and integrity, just as I appreciated Romney’s dedication to country and his strong convictions.”

This gesture has sparked conversations across social media platforms, with many users praising Obama’s emphasis on unity and mutual respect. Some view it as a reminder of how political figures can model dignity, even amidst ideological differences. Others have noted how rare such sentiments have become in today’s polarized political climate, making Obama’s words all the more meaningful.
